Transponder Codes

When a transponder gets interrogated, it sends a signal encoded with an eight-digit code. This signal, referred to as a SQUAWK Code is used to identify aircraft on radar screens. It is also used to transmit specific messages to air traffic control in the case of an emergency or to alert air traffic controllers of changing weather conditions. Squawk codes are frequently utilized to communicate with ATC in situations where the pilot is unable to speak on the radio, and are very important to ensure safe flying.

Every aircraft is equipped with a transponder that responds to radar queries with an identifier code. This enables ATC to identify an aircraft on a busy screen. Transponders come in a variety of modes that differ in how they respond to questions. Mode A transmits only the code, whereas mode C also provides altitude information. Mode S transponders transmit more detailed information like callsigns as well as position. This can be helpful in airspace that is crowded.

A common sight is a small beige box under the seat of a pilot in all aircraft. The transponder is a small beige-colored box that is used to transmit the SQUAWK code every time the air traffic control is activated on the aircraft. The transponder may be set to the 'ON' and 'ALT' or SBY (standby position) positions.

It's not uncommon to hear a pilot instructed by air traffic control to "squawk ident". This is a directive for the pilots to press their transponder IDENT button. The ident button causes the aircraft to blink on ATC's radar screens and allows them to easily identify your aircraft's location on the screen.

VIN Numbers

VIN numbers can be used to identify vehicles and provide a wealth information about them. VIN numbers are unique to every vehicle on the planet and are not applicable to alien vehicles (or whatever). The 17 digits of a VIN code are a combination of numbers and letters that can be decoded to reveal vital information about your vehicle or truck.

Modern automobiles are digital libraries that hold an abundance of information regarding their history and the specifications. The auto key programmer to accessing this information is the VIN number. This lets you determine everything from if your car was involved in a recall, to how many owners it has.

A VIN number is comprised of several sections, each with specific information. The first digit, for example is the type of vehicle it is, such as the passenger car, pickup truck or SUV. The second digit indicates the manufacturer. The third digit represents the assembly division of the vehicle. The fourth through eighth digits indicate the model type, the restraint system type and body type, as well as the transmission and engine codes. The ninth number is the check digit, which prevents fraud by ensuring that the VIN number hasn't been altered.

In North America, the 10th through 17th digits of the VIN code are referred to as the Vehicle Identification Section, or VIS. The tenth digit is the year of the vehicle's production, and the eleventh digit shows the assembly plant that produced the vehicle. The digits tenth through seventeenth may also contain additional information such as features or options that are installed inside the vehicle.
